To finance: summarising the open capacity item before I hand over to Ines Varga. The Copperline plant decision is unresolved. Board approved study funds only; no capex committed. Two options remain: extend the Copperline annex (lower cost, 14-month build) or contract overflow to Hestwick Industrial (faster, thinner margins). My recommendation is the annex, contingent on the Q2 demand reforecast. All figures are in the shared model; Ines owns sign-off from Monday. The strategic rationale is appended below.

management briefing: Silethax Systems plans to raise the Holix list price by 50.2 percent in December. The steering committee signed off on a budget of $329.9 million for Project Holok. The renewal with Juldorax Foods closes at $278.2 million a year, 54.3 percent above the last contract. Project Briir slips by one quarter because of the supplier delay.

Subject: Search reindex cut-over complete

Hi Renna,

The nightly search reindex for Quillbase moved to the new Arbor pipeline last night at 02:00. The run completed in 41 minutes, well under the old 2-hour window, and spot checks on the staging index matched production counts exactly. The old cron entry has been disabled but not deleted. The active settings are listed below.

deployment values, kajep-kageg:
[praix]
host = praix.paliqcorp.corp
user = praix_svc
database = praix_prod

## Ownership

The ProctorQueue service handles exam session intake, candidate ordering, and invigilator assignment for Quillgate Assessments. Release cuts require sign-off from the queue owner; no exceptions during exam windows. Freeze periods are listed in the release calendar. For approvals, paging, and rollback authority, contact the owner listed below.

named custodian: Belius Casath Ulaix Sorius